Laith Marouf: Hezbollah to Obliterate Israeli Plan and Smash Northern Buffer Zone
About this episode
This interview examines the escalating conflict in Southern Lebanon, highlighting ongoing Israeli attacks, steadfast local resistance, and the Lebanese government's growing irrelevance. The discussion expands to Syria’s severe humanitarian and security collapse under HTS and Turkish influence, dismissing narratives of a genuine Turkish-Israeli confrontation. It analyzes the Axis of Resistance’s strategic patience to stretch the conflict, aiming to exacerbate Western economic decline and force a US withdrawal without triggering broader escalation. Finally, the conversation addresses the urgent need for a unified, sovereign Arab-Islamic bloc to counter imperialism, the rising popular unity in support of Palestine across sectarian lines, and the unchecked ethnic cleansing in the West Bank.
